4. Think Question - Why did John Smith create a "no work, no food" policy?

John Smith created a "no work, no food" policy because he wanted all the colony of Jamestown, Virginia to commit to the success of that first colony founded in 1607.  Jhon Smith realized how difficult it was going to prosper in a new land with that kind of weather and the difficult situation to start anew. So he did not want anybody to take a "free ride" attitude. That is when he said that there would be bo food for those lazy people who did not want to work hard.
